  2. 18 de mai. de 2024 · Mount Holyoke College was the first of the Seven Sisters – prestigious liberal arts colleges for women on the East Coast of the United States. At a time when education was male-dominated, founding Mount Holyoke was a great step forward. The Seven Sisters became known as the female equivalent of the (formerly all-male) Ivy League.   5. Five College Consortium Mount Holyoke is part of the Five College Consortium, which also includes Amherst, Hampshire, and Smith Colleges, and the University of Massachusetts at Amherst. The consortium connects students to 30,000 other students and the vast academic and social resources of not just one but four prominent colleges and a flagship research university, at no extra charge.

  7. 18 de set. de 2023 · Mount Holyoke was ranked #48 on the College-Access Index, with 29% of first-year students in 2020–21 receiving Pell Grants.
